Why is it difficult for Mai Duc Chung to become the head coach of the Vietnamese women's team at the 2023 World Cup?
FIFA regulations require that the head coach must have a Pro license to lead the team to participate in the 2023 Women's World Cup finals.
Although very "good at it", coach Mai Duc Chung may not be able to continue leading the women's team to participate.World Cup 2023for not meeting FIFA's conditions.
From now until July 2023 is very short, so it is impossible for Coach Mai Duc Chung to attend courses to get this additional degree. This information makes football fans disappointed because Coach Mai Duc Chung is very "lucky" with Vietnamese women's football.
![]() |
Coach Mai Duc Chung. |
After winning the 2023 World Cup with his players, Coach Mai Duc Chung wants someone else to replace him to lead the women's football team. He can take on the role of advisor if trusted by the VFF. On the contrary, the VFF leadership wants the 71-year-old strategist to continue his duties at the 2023 World Cup.
The contract between coach Mai Duc Chung and VFF is valid until the end of 2022. Therefore, in the immediate future, Mr. Chung will continue to lead the women's football team at the 31st SEA Games. The goal of the Vietnamese team in this tournament is to successfully defend the gold medal.
However, FIFA regulations may force VFF to change its plans and quickly search for a qualified coach. Currently, there are only 12 Vietnamese coaches with a Pro license, of which Ms. Phan Thi Anh Dao is the first female coach with a FIFA Pro license. Another option is to choose a foreign coach to lead the Vietnamese women's team.
In case VFF still wantsCoach Mai Duc ChungAccompanying the Vietnam women's team, the 71-year-old coach can stay in the role of Technical Director/advisor at the 2023 World Cup.
Chinese team captain accused of selling match against Vietnam
Chinese media said that Chinese fans demanded that the CFA investigate match-fixing by captain Wu Xi and defender Wang Shenchao.
After the humiliating defeat to the Vietnamese team on February 1, Chinese fans have not yet calmed down as they continue to demand that the Chinese Football Association (CFA) investigate match-fixing by the players.
According to Sohu, fans of the “billion-people country” team want the CFA to open an investigation into captain Wu Xi and defender Wang Shenchao. The newspaper wrote: “The overall performance of the team in the match against Vietnam was not good, but there were two players who showed particularly excessive weakness. Therefore, the fans want to investigate them.

The first one is Wu Xi, he has signs of dodging the ball. The second one is defender Wang Shenchao, he is the one who lost the ball in the team's goals. And whether he intentionally lost or not, the Chinese team should immediately correct it." The author analyzed that CFA does not hesitate to spend money to bring in naturalized players.
However, up to this point, the Chinese team's performance has not improved at all and they even lost to Vietnam - the team that is at the bottom of the group in the final qualifying round of the 2022 World Cup. "It is true that our level is not too strong and cannot be compared to Japan or Saudi Arabia. But with the naturalized players that the team possesses, we must at least be stronger than the Vietnamese team. Right now, the CFA needs to urgently answer the question: are the Chinese players playing without effort and intentionally losing to the Vietnamese team?", Sohu commented.
The Sohu writer also reiterated journalist Li Xuan’s comments on the Football News website and said that this was a “very strange” match. “Journalist Li Xuan implied that some Chinese players played football with a fake attitude, and did not rule out that some people wanted to make money from the match with the Vietnamese team.
According to information, CFA has launched an investigation after these reflections. If true, the consequences they will have to bear will be extremely serious and the path back to the team will officially be closed," the author commented.
Match schedule of U23 Southeast Asia 2022
At the 2022 Southeast Asian U23 tournament, coach Dinh The Nam and his team will be in Group C with U23 Singapore and U23 Thailand. According to the schedule of the 2022 Southeast Asian U23 tournament, U23 Vietnam will have the first match off on February 16, then meet U23 Singapore on February 19 and meet U23 Thailand on February 22.
The captain ofU23 Vietnamsharing about the preparation for the competition in Cambodia: “I think U23 Vietnam, like many other teams, has a very thorough preparation process. U23 Vietnam has more than a month of concentration and training together.”

According to the format of the U23 Southeast Asian tournament, the teams will compete in a round robin to calculate the ranking points in each group, selecting the 3 first-place teams and 1 second-place team with the best results to compete in the semi-finals. The two winning teams in the semi-finals will compete for the championship, the two losing teams in the semi-finals will meet in the bronze medal match.
Teams are allowed to register a maximum of 28 players for the tournament but are only allowed to register 23 players for each match. Vietnam U23 will wear white in the match against Singapore U23 on February 19 and all red in the match against Thailand U23 on February 22.
MU close to contract with Tielemans
British media reported that the possibility of MU owning Youri Tielemans in this summer's transfer window is very high.
Tielemans has a contract with Leicester until June 2023 and there has been no progress on a contract extension.

Leicester's crisis, with the possibility of not being able to qualify for the European Cup next season, has made the Belgian midfielder think even more about leaving.
Recently, coach Brendan Rodgers admitted that the interest of MU and some other big clubs in Tielemans is normal. Leicester also soon determined that they were forced to sell this 24-year-old player.
MU is finalizing the fees with Leicester, as well as negotiating with Peter Smeets - Tielemans' representative about the details of the contract terms.
